  • Q: How to replace the ignition coil on 2008 Chevrolet Aveo?
    A: The first step to replace the Ignition Coil requires disconnecting both the negative Battery Cable and electronic ignition (EI) system Ignition Coil connector. Before removing the ignition wire make a mental note of its current placement. The first step involves removing the retaining nuts from the ei system Ignition Coil followed by removing the coil itself. Secure the ei system Ignition Coil in its mounting position through retaining nuts with torque set to 10 n.m (89 lb in). Reinstall both the ei system Ignition Coil connector and the negative Battery Cable in their proper locations.
